Job Description
We are looking for strong, self-directed software developers who are confident in their skill set, but also open to learning new things and tackling new and interesting challenges.
ROLE AND RESPONSIBILITIES
• Must have at least 3 years of experience in the relevant field
• Ability to handle multiple projects and teams.
• Efficient in mentoring the junior developers
• Excellent Team Management skill
• Expert in Python Django
• Creating code utilizing Python, Django, HTML and CSS.
• Working directly with the product team to bring our product to the top.
• Experience in creating microservices-based applications
• Deploying Web applications to Linux environments
• Troubleshooting bugs or other difficult problems to solve
• Accomplish engineering and organization mission by completing related results as needed.
• Collaborate with the team to brainstorm and create new products.
• Grow engineering teams by interviewing, recruiting, and hiring.
• Understand business needs and know how to create the tools to manage them.
• Comply with the project plan and stay on the leading edge of development practices.
• The ability to explain technical jargon to peers and the ability to build a website from start to finish to the highest standard.
candidate should have expertise in the following areas:
• Python and Django
• Relational Databases
• Webservices
• Git
• Software design with a focus on maintainability and extensibility.
Extra credits if you know:
• Node
• React
• Elastic Stack